HOUSE RULES-AMEND
This bill amends House Rule 59 to increase the vote threshold required for a "previous question" motion from 60 to 71 members. The previous question is a procedural motion used to end debate and force an immediate vote on a pending bill or amendment. The change directly affects House members during floor debates, requiring a larger supermajority to cut off discussion and move to a vote. This is a procedural rule change impacting internal House voting mechanics, not a substantive policy.
